The following is an introduction to BYD's DM-i technology: 1. Advantages of BYD DM-i: DM-i possesses multiple advantages that lead other hybrid technologies, with its "core philosophy" being electricity as the primary power source and fuel as supplementary. Architecturally, the DM-i Super Hybrid is based on a high-capacity battery and high-power electric motor. During driving, the vehicle relies on the high-power motor for propulsion, while the gasoline engine's main function is to charge the battery. It directly drives the wheels only when additional power is needed, and even then, it works in coordination with the motor to reduce load. This hybrid technology differs from traditional hybrid technologies that rely heavily on the engine, thereby achieving more effective fuel consumption reduction. 2. BYD DM-i's engine: The core component of BYD's DM-i Super Hybrid technology is the newly developed Xiaoyun plug-in hybrid dedicated engine, which comes in two versions: a 1.5L engine primarily used in Qin PLUS and Song PLUS, and a 1.5T turbocharged engine used in the larger Tang DM-i model. These models feature two key components: the EHS dual-motor system and the DM-i Super Hybrid dedicated Blade Battery, along with a series of vehicle control systems, engine control systems, motor control systems, and battery management systems, collectively forming the Super Hybrid system. Most importantly, these core components and key technologies are entirely independently developed by BYD.

Why Can the Car Key Only Be Inserted Halfway?

Possible reasons include foreign objects blocking the keyhole, which you can try to observe and clean yourself. Below are some precautions for using car keys: Avoid contact with metal objects: Since keys are metal products, smart keys may malfunction if they come into contact with or are covered by metal items. Do not use the wrong battery: The battery life of a smart car key is approximately one year. Battery consumption varies depending on the frequency of use and the distance from which the key is operated. Be very careful when replacing the battery in a smart car key, as any mistake could damage the circuit board inside the key. Do not leave the spare key in the car: Losing a car key due to improper storage can cause many inconveniences, especially for smart keys. If lost, not only will you need to have a new one made, but it will also require reprogramming with the car's computer.

Which button to press to eject the car disc?

To eject the car disc, press the "EJECT" button or the button with an arrow symbol next to the disc slot. After pressing, the disc will automatically eject. Here is more information about car DVD: Introduction: Car DVD is a multimedia playback system installed in cars to provide audio-visual entertainment for passengers. Generally, in addition to playing DVD format discs, Casda car DVD also supports audio-visual files and discs in formats such as VCD/MP3/WMA/MP4/Divx/CD/CDR/CDRW/JPEG, and some also support SD, USB, IPOD, etc. Classification: According to the installation position in the car, it can be divided into sun visor DVD, ceiling-mounted DVD, headrest DVD, single-din double-din DVD, etc.

What is the length of the Toyota Avalon in meters?

The Toyota Avalon has a length of 4975mm, a width of 1850mm, a height of 1450mm, and a wheelbase of 2870mm. The Toyota Avalon is a mid-size sedan equipped with two types of engines: a 2.0-liter naturally aspirated engine and a 2.5-liter naturally aspirated engine. The 2.0-liter naturally aspirated engine delivers a maximum power of 178 horsepower and a maximum torque of 210 Nm, with the maximum power achieved at 6600 rpm and the maximum torque between 4400 to 5200 rpm, paired with a CVT transmission. The 2.5-liter naturally aspirated engine produces a maximum power of 209 horsepower and a maximum torque of 250 Nm, achieving maximum power at 6600 rpm and maximum torque at 5000 rpm, paired with an 8AT transmission.

Reasons for White Smoke from Diesel Engines?

There are two main reasons for white smoke from vehicle exhaust: low temperature and water entering the cylinders. Below is a detailed explanation of the causes of white exhaust smoke in winter: Low Temperature: Normal combustion of gasoline can cause white smoke from the exhaust pipe. The primary products of complete gasoline combustion are carbon dioxide and water, along with small amounts of other impurities. Due to low winter temperatures, both the exhaust pipe and the air inside it are cold. When the engine is first started, water vapor expelled from the cylinders rapidly condenses into mist upon encountering the cold exhaust pipe and air. This mist is expelled as white smoke. Water in Cylinders: Water entering the cylinders can produce large amounts of white smoke. If the cylinder head gasket is damaged, the seal between the cylinder block and cylinder head becomes compromised, allowing coolant to leak into the contact area between them. In severe cases, coolant may even flow directly into the oil passages. Water in the cylinders evaporates into steam, which is then expelled through the exhaust pipe as white smoke.

Are the engines of the Toyota 86 and Subaru BRZ the same?

Toyota 86 and Subaru BRZ share the same engine. Both vehicles are equipped with a horizontally opposed naturally aspirated four-cylinder engine, coded FA20, with a displacement of 2.0 liters. This engine incorporates Toyota's hybrid injection technology, which allows for different fuel injection methods under various operating conditions, thereby enhancing engine efficiency and power output. The exterior design of the Toyota 86 originates from TOYOTA's European design center ED2 located in Nice, France. It evolved from the FTHS concept car unveiled by Toyota in 2007, featuring a somewhat European styling influence while still distinctly reflecting its TOYOTA lineage. The Subaru BRZ boasts a more sporty exterior design, fitted with 225/40ZR18 Michelin Pilot Super Sport tires, reinforced chassis, and a wheelbase of 2570mm.
